London Councils calls on government to speed up resettlement scheme amid services ‘struggling to cope’

Minister for Afghan resettlement, Victoria Atkins, said the government was “proud” that the country had provided homes for 4,000 evacuees and school places for around 6,000 children in a short period of time.
